Abstract

Wholly aromatic polyamides and their shaped articles containing at least 85 mole percent of repeat units of m-phenylene isophthalamide: ##STR1## and repeat units of selected aromatic diamines and diacid chlorides exhibit improved flame resistance while retaining good thermal stability.
